Job Description
Position Overview
The Product Specialist Sales works in the mid market segment, in collaboration with the Mexico portfolio owners, to amplify and expand sales in secondary accounts, with technical and commercial skills. This role is crucial to the growth and adoption of technology in the most important Mexico accounts.
You will be engaging with established, large customers as a product specialist sales representative to position the AEC (Architecture, Engineering and Construction) solutions in a manner that drives transformational business outcomes for a specific set of pre-defined high potential customers. You will be driving account planning and customer relationship development with the account portfolio owner, and working with both our internal pre-sales team and partner companies to provide guidance and support to your client’s business goals. You will be able to utilize your combination of industry knowledge, business and sales strategy expertise, product knowledge and account management experience to reach both sales quota and customer value goals.
